Circadian rhythms and sleep parameters (such as chronotype and sleep stage/timing alignment) significantly influence sleep inertia and physiological readiness, thereby defining the optimal and easiest times for humans to wake up.

The circadian system modulates the cortisol awakening response in humans
2022 · cited by 33
Paper 0 demonstrates robust circadian rhythmicity in cortisol awakening responses, highlighting biological readiness states.

Morning sleep inertia and its associated factors: Findings from a nationwide study.
2026 · cited by 1
Paper 7 identifies clear links between chronotype, sleep duration, and morning sleep inertia upon awakening.
Kairos study protocol: a multidisciplinary approach to the study of school timing and its effects on health, well-being and students' performance.
2024 · cited by 1
Paper 10 discusses how the match or mismatch between biological chronotypes and social schedules impacts human alertness and performance.
